Professional Background
Todd Hurt is an accomplished executive with extensive experience in network development and provider contracting within the health services sector. His career at Prime Health Services, Inc, spans several high-level roles, showcasing his exceptional leadership and strategic skills in enhancing healthcare accessibility and efficiency. Currently, Todd serves as the Executive Vice President of Network Development at Prime Health Services, Inc, where he spearheads initiatives aimed at expanding the company's network of healthcare providers.
Throughout his time at Prime Health Services, Todd has held multiple prestigious positions, including Vice President of Provider Contracting and Director of Provider Contracting. His progressive career trajectory within the organization demonstrates his ability to adapt and drive significant advancements in provider relationships, negotiation strategies, and overall network development. Todd's expertise in the healthcare sector is further supported by his role as an Independent Contractor at HEOPS, where he contributed his insights and strategies in healthcare operations and support.
